#5758c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5758c4 is composed of 34.1% red, 34.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.6% cyan, 55.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 239.4 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 55.5%. #5758c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eb0ff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5758c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5758c4 has RGB values of R:87, G:88,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 5724356.

Shades and Tints of #5758c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020206 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5758c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8b90 is the less saturated color, while #2325f8 is the most saturated one.
